Inscription
66,427,245
Inscription Details
Inscription ID 93ed39......b8a7i0 | Number 66,427,245 |
Owner bc1pkl......hj30xu | Output Size 330 Sats |
Content Type text/plain;charset=utf-8 | Content Size 0.05 KB |
Creation Date March 29, 2024.
494 days ago | Creation Fee 1,661 Sats |
Creation Tx 93ed39......4cb8a7 | Block 836856 |
Previous ab9a15......dda6i0 | Next bf244d......5aa9i0 |
Satoshi Details
Sat Number 1,563,076,076,929,082 |
Sat Name ctwcqpajctb |
Sat Creation Block 415,230 |
Sat Creation Date 6/7/2016 |
Rarity common |